How Our Team Handles Bathroom Water Damage Restoration

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ure your bathroom is restored to its original state. We use advanced equipment, such as moisture meters and drying fans, to assess the damage and develop a customized plan. Our technicians will then work tirelessly to dry your bathroom, remove any damaged materials, and disinfect the area to prevent mold growth.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our team arrives on-site and assesses the damage to find out the best course of action. We’ll contain the affected area to prevent further damage and ensure a safe working environment.

Step 2: Water Removal and Drying

We’ll use specialized equipment to remove standing water and begin the drying process. Our technicians will monitor moisture levels to ensure everything is dry and safe.

Step 3: Material Removal and Disinfection

We’ll remove any damaged materials, such as drywall or flooring, and disinfect the area to prevent mold growth.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ring your bathroom is safe to use.

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ction

Once the area is dry and safe, our team will begin the repair and reconstruction process. We’ll work with you to ensure everything is restored to its original state.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Clean-up

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ure everything is complete and to your satisfaction. We’ll also clean up any debris and leave your bathroom looking like new.

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ak in the bathroom Yes No You can likely fix it yourself with a few basic tools and materials.
Water damage to a large section of the bathroom No Yes It’s likely too extensive for a DIY repair, and a professional will ensure it’s done correctly and safely.
Visible mold growth in the bathroom No Yes Mold can be hazardous to your health, and a professional will ensure it’s removed and prevented from growing back.
Water damage to the bathroom’s structural elements (e.g., walls, floors) No Yes A professional will ensure the structural integrity of your bathroom is maintained and any necessary repairs are made.
Water damage to electrical parts in the bathroom No Yes Electrical parts can be hazardous, and a professional will ensure they’re safely repaired or replaced.

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ration Cost in St. Augustine Shores, FL

The cost of bathroom water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in St. Augustine Shores, FL. These estimates are based on typical prices for this service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the job
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,000 The amount of water and the equipment needed to dry the area
Material Removal and Disinfection $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ed to restore the area
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ed to restore the area
Final Inspection and Clean-up $100 – $500 The complexity of the job and the materials needed for clean-up

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. Free estimates are available to ensure you know exactly what to expect.
